‘Tom’ Bailey Jr., 54, of Houghton Lake

‘Tom’ Bailey Jr. of Houghton Lake Charles Thomas “Tom” Bailey Jr., 54, of Houghton Lake passed away unexpectedly on Wednesday March 24, 2021.

Tom was born on July 14, 1966 in Lansing to Charles and Rebecca (Grantier) Bailey. He moved to the Houghton Lake area with his family at an early age and attended Houghton Lake Community Schools. He was a member of the 1985 graduating class. Following High School, Tom served as a PVT in the Marines. He was married on September 17, 1994 in Houghton Lake to Kristina L. Tesler. Tom was a heavy equipment operator working for Operating Engineers Union Local 324.  He enjoyed playing pool and darts, but his true love was the outdoors.  Tom was an avid hunter and fisherman and loved spending time with his family.

Surviving Mr. Bailey are his son, Charles T Bailey, III of Gladstone; daughter, Madison Bailey of Escanaba; former wife Kristina Bailey of Escanaba; three sisters, Valerie Kirtland of West Bloomfield,, Tina Barnes of Grand Rapids, and Liza Forbes of West Bloomfield. uncle and aunt, Ron and Ann Johnson of Florida;  several nieces, nephews, and cousins.  Tom was preceded in death by his parents. 

 In Lieu of flowers and donations the family asks that you take a moment to hug your child, grandchild, or friend, or take a walk in the woods for a moment, an hour, or a day.
